30 mi
TELUS International
Baytown, TX
Discover more
InergroupInsourcingSolutions
DoorDash
Houston, TX
Lowe's
Keurig Dr Pepper
NetApp
Powell Industries
ALDI
Privacy Policy, Terms of Use, and Your Privacy Choices